In this session, we will explore the importance of understanding and recognizing generational anxiety. Attendees will utilize historical factors to determine when the anxious generations began, how and if their anxieties were treated, and when they began having children of their own. Are there ways we as clinicians can be introspective and recognize
some of these behaviors and symptoms in our own lives? What may be the best approach when generation anxieties are present?
Objectives:
- Define when the anxious generations began and what started the trend & recognize the importance of understanding generational anxiety and examine the impact generational anxiety has on mental health.
- Attendees will be able to identify the symptoms of generational anxiety by gaining an understanding of the larger lens perspective.
- Explore and discuss best approaches, resources, and solutions when working with anxious children who come from homes with anxiety. What approaches might you take and what might need to be changed to better adjust for this population?
